How they compare

Tonga currently reports 52.53 against 52.5 in Tunisia, a difference of 0.03.

Across all 5 years both countries report, Tonga has been ahead every year.

Tonga ranks 98th and Tunisia ranks 100th of 180 countries.

Tonga has averaged higher in every one of the 1 decades both report.

The score for postfiling index benchmarks economies with respect to the regulatory best practice on the indicator. The score is indicated on a scale from 0 to 100, where 0 represents the worst regulatory performance and 100 the best regulatory performance, and is computed based on the methodology in the DB17-20 studies.
